Output 9896970c3b1c5a54667785540e0425e46d2571014aa81cbdd24d7e8e74b322eb:2

value
26104000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8d5d45bd76b2dd4bc020044626fec43a47a3477 OP_EQUAL
address
MV8HA54RyrMFoeBXJPZNvQqjjq8XCiBNv3
transaction
9896970c3b1c5a54667785540e0425e46d2571014aa81cbdd24d7e8e74b322eb
spent
true